Ten days in Canada will not be enough time to see all of Canada’s highlights, but it will be adequate for exploring one region or province. Travelers may choose between staying on-the-go or focusing on one area to explore.
This example itinerary focuses on the western provinces of Alberta and British Columbia.
Day 1-2, Calgary: Calgary is a major metropolitan city filled with museums, restaurants, and exciting attractions. Go shopping, attend a festival, or have a picnic in one of the city’s many parks.
Day 3-4, Banff National Park: Drive to scenic Banff for hiking in the summer or skiing in the winter. See wildlife, visit the hot springs, and take in the beauty of the Canadian Rockies.
Day 5, Lake Louise: Be sure to set aside a full day to explore beautiful Lake Louise. The lake is Instagram-famous for its clear, turquoise waters. Pack a lunch and spend a day out on kayaks in the lake.
Day 6-7, Whistler: Whistler is one of the world’s top ski destinations and a favorite vacation spot for people all around the world. The town of Whistler is filled with bars, shops, and restaurants to cozy up in after a day of skiing or hiking.
Day 8-9, Vancouver: Experience the art and music scene of bustling Vancouver. Visit the famous Capilano Suspension Bridge or go on a whale-watching tour to see humpback whales and orcas.
Day 10, Victoria: A short ferry ride from Vancouver, Victoria is the capital of British Columbia. The Butchart Gardens are among the world’s top gardens and well worth a visit. Other attractions include the Royal BC Museum and Hatley Castle.

Despite the size and multitude of tourist destinations in the United States, seeing the major highlights in three weeks is achievable with an active tour group. Some tour operators offer coast-to-coast tours across the country, allowing travelers to experience many regions of the United States.
Day 1-2, San Francisco: See the iconic Golden Gate Bridge, shop in Union Square, and catch a Giant’s game in the City by the Bay.
Day 3-4, Yosemite National Park: Hike and take in the stunning views of Yosemite National Park. Adventurous travelers may choose to camp overnight or take on the all-day hike up Half Dome (reservations required).
Day 5-7, Los Angeles: Spot celebrities and hang out on the beach in sunny Los Angeles. Visit the Griffith Observatory at night for star-gazing and a view of the city lights below.
Day 8-9, Las Vegas: Experience the world-famous nightlife of Las Vegas, or visit the Hoover Dam or Lake Mead for more scenic views.
Day 10, Grand Canyon: Watch the sun setting over the Grand Canyon in Arizona. Hike in the gorge or simply enjoy the view.
Day 11-12, Albuquerque: Admire the Spanish colonial architecture and taste the flavorful cuisine of New Mexico’s largest city.
Day 13-14, St. Louis: See the trademark arches and sip a craft beer at one of St. Louis’ historic breweries.
Day 15-17, Chicago: See the city from the SkyDeck at Willis Tower, tour Wrigley Field, and stroll along the lakefront in the Windy City.
Day 18-19, Washington, D.C.: Tour the nation’s capitol on foot-- you can visit one of the city’s world-class museums, see the White House, or shop in Georgetown.
Day 20-21, New York City: Times Square, Central Park, and the Statue of Liberty are just a few of the many attractions that NYC has to offer.

Mexico is a country filled with culture and history. Many tourists never leave their resorts and miss out on all of the cities, beaches, and landmarks that Mexico has to offer. A 10-day tour in Mexico will give you enough time to enjoy the beaches while learning about Mexican culture.
Day 1-2, Mexico City: Mexico City is famous for its stunning architecture and an emphasis on the arts. Visit the Palacio de Bellas Artes or taste delicious street food.
Day 3-4, Oaxaca: Enjoy the delicious food and ancient ruins of Oaxaca. Be sure to visit the abandoned city of Monte Alban.
Day 5-6, Cancún: Relax on the beach, go snorkelling, and swim in underground caves in this famous resort town.
Day 7-8, Chichen Itza: Located on the Yucatan Peninsula, Chichen Itza is a UNESCO Heritage Site where visitors can learn about Mexico’s pre-Columbian history.
Day 9-10, Playa del Carmen: Finish out your trip enjoying the white sandy beaches and turquoise waters of Playa del Carmen.
